Warm the Milk: Heat the milk gently in a saucepan until it’s warm but not boiling. Warming the milk helps in better mixing with the olive oil.
Add Olive Oil: Add the olive oil to the warm milk and stir thoroughly. The warmth will help disperse the olive oil evenly throughout the milk.
Mix Well: Use a whisk or an immersion blender to mix the olive oil and milk thoroughly. This ensures that the oil is well integrated and doesn’t float just on top.
Serve Warm or Cool: You can enjoy this mixture warm, or let it cool down and store it in the refrigerator. Some prefer it chilled, while others enjoy the comforting warmth.
Serving Suggestions:
Drink a small glass as part of your breakfast or before bedtime.
Use it as a base for smoothies to add nutritional value.
Considerations:
If you have a dairy intolerance or a specific health condition that restricts the intake of fats or dairy, consult with a healthcare provider before trying this recipe.
Remember, moderation is key, especially when consuming dietary fats, even healthy ones like olive oil.
